Primary Outcome
|
| Outcome |
TimePoints |
| The primary outcome is the onset of complete sensory and motor blockade at after LA injection. |
. The sensory blockade of the four nerves will be evaluated and graded every 3 mins until 30 mins after injection by double blinded observers using a 3 point scale (0 = no block , 1 = analgesia i.e patient can feel touch but not cold, 2 = anaesthesia i.e patient cannot feel touch). Motor blockade will be tested and graded according to a 3 point scale ( 0 = no block, 1 = paresis, 2 = paralysis). Motor blockade of each nerve will be evaluated by elbow flexion for (MCN), wrist flexion for (MN), wrist extension for (RN), flexion and opposition of fifth finger towards the thumb for (UN).

Secondary Outcome
|
| Outcome |
TimePoints |
To compare the performance time, number of needle passess and duration of analgesia between the two techniques.
To assess the incidence of complications such as hemidiaphragmatic dysfunction, pneumothorax, Horners syndrome and vessel puncture.
To assess the incidence of block failure or rescue analgesia.
|
VAS score will be assessed to elicit the duration of post operative analgesia at predetermined time intervals 0th (at the onset of sensory blockade), 2, 4, 6, 12, 18, 24th hour. To assess the incidence of diaphragmatic dysfunction,anaesthesiologist will perform repeat ultrasound within 1 hour of the patient’s arrival in the recovery room after the surgery. |

Brief Summary
|
One of the most popular methods of administering anaesthesia and pain releif for upper limb surgery is a regional brachial plexus block. Brachial plexus can be blocked by supraclavicular, infraclavicular, costoclavicular, axillary and interscalene approaches.
The use of ultrasound in these blocks enhances the success rates and reduces complications significantly. It improves the visualisation of nerve bundles, enables real time assessment of needle placement and this has lead to reduction in the total volume of anaesthetic drugs required. It also helps in avoiding crucial structures such as pleura, blood vessels and enhances the precision of the local anaesthesic drug infiltration along the targeted nerves.
Supraclavicular brachial plexus block(SCBPB) is often called the spinal anaesthesia of the arm, due to its rapid onset of blockade. For the supraclavicular (SC) approach, the trunk and divisions of the brachial plexus are arranged compactly superolaterally around the subclavian artery at the supraclavicular fossa. However, complications such as hemidiaphragmatic paralysis due to phrenic nerve blockade, Horner’s syndrome due to sympathetic nerve block and pneumothorax may occur.
Costoclavicular approach of BPB is a modification of ultrasound guided infraclavicular approach of BPB. Under ultrasound guidance, the costoclavicular space (CCS) is visualised as a well defined intermuscular space , lying deep and posterior to midpoint of clavicle. It is located between the clavicular head of pectoralis major and subclavius muscle anteriorly and the upper slips of serrtus anterior muscle and second rib posteriorly. All 3 cords of brachial plexus are more superficial and visualized in a single transverse sonogram of CCS as the cords are clustered together lateral to axillary artery. Therefore a a low dose of LA(local anaesthetic) and single injection would provide more effective blockade. Block needle can be easily directed to the centre of the plexus with minimal discomfort to patient.
The danger of vascular puncture and pleural puncture is minimized with costoclavicular approach as the nerve cords are first approached before vessel and the pleura. |
